SQLSTATE[3D000]エラーの原因と解決方法


  1. データベース接続の問題:

    • データベースの接続情報(ホスト名、ユーザー名、パスワード)が正しくない場合、このエラーが発生することがあります。接続情報を再確認し、正しい値を使用して接続してください。
  2. テーブルまたはカラムが存在しない:

    • クエリで指定されたテーブルやカラムが存在しない場合、このエラーが発生します。テーブルやカラムの名前が正しいかどうかを確認し、存在しない場合は作成する必要があります。
  3. クエリの構文エラー:

    • クエリの構文が正しくない場合、このエラーが発生します。クエリを再確認し、正しい構文を使用してください。例えば、カンマや引用符の不足、誤ったキーワードの使用などが原因となることがあります。
  4. 権限の問題:

    • データベースユーザーに必要な権限が与えられていない場合、このエラーが発生することがあります。必要な権限(SELECT、INSERT、UPDATEなど)を確認し、適切に設定してください。
  5. データベースの容量制限:

    • データベースが容量制限に達している場合、新しいデータを追加する際にこのエラーが発生することがあります。データベースの容量を確認し、必要な場合は容量を拡張してください。